Refinancing Your Home Equity Loan or Line of Credit: What to Consider


Before deciding to refinance your home equity loan or line of credit, it’s crucial to evaluate your options. Here are some key questions to consider:

1. What Are the Costs Involved?
Determine the expenses associated with refinancing and any changes in the interest rate. Use the numerous free refinance calculators available online to assess if the costs justify the benefits.

2. Are You Seeking Better Loan Terms?
Refinancing can offer improved loan terms such as a fixed rate or a shorter pay-off period, like shifting from 30 to 15 years. Even if the financial savings are minimal, opting for more favorable terms can make refinancing worthwhile.

3. Are Closing Costs Added to the Loan Balance?
If you’re including closing costs in your loan, remember that you’ll pay interest on these costs over time. Factor these costs and the interest payments of your current loan into your calculations to determine potential savings.

4. Will You Need Your Home Equity Line of Credit in the Future?
Having a line of credit available can be beneficial, especially if you lack substantial savings. If you refinance and later need funds, securing a new line of credit might be challenging. Consider keeping your existing line if future access to funds is a concern.

By carefully weighing these factors, you can make an informed decision about whether refinancing your home equity loan or line of credit is the best move for your financial situation.
